New Zealand Climate Considerations

Indoor cultivators can control their environment regardless of location, but Romulan rewards specific adjustments for New Zealand conditions. During summer months when ambient temperatures regularly exceed 30°C, running lights at night (6pm-6am cycle) prevents heat stress without expensive cooling. Relative humidity targets: 55-65% in veg, dropping to 40-50% once flowers form. EC targets: 1.0-1.4 during vegetative growth, stepping up to 1.6-2.0 at peak bloom. pH maintained between 5.8 and 6.3 depending on your medium.

Terpene Breakdown

Primary: Myrcene · Secondary: Humulene · Tertiary: Linalool. Flavour translation from flower to vapour and smoke differs with this terpene combination. Low-temperature vaporisation (180-188°C) highlights the humulene and linalool notes whilst keeping myrcene as a foundation. Higher temperatures or combustion flatten the profile into a single-note experience — still pleasant, but lacking the complexity that makes this cultivar genuinely interesting to those who appreciate flavour.

Suitability and Recommendations

Romulan suits growers with fundamental skills already established. You should understand pH management, basic nutrient ratios, and light cycle requirements before committing to this cultivar — it will not hold your hand, but it will not punish minor mistakes harshly either. Photoperiod genetics give you complete control over plant size and harvest timing — extend the vegetative phase for larger plants or flip early for a quicker turnaround in compact spaces. The New Zealand growing season (October through April) accommodates the 8 weeks bloom period comfortably for outdoor growers in the warmer northern regions.
